Indigenous Healthcare Career Exploration Camp

June 11-13, 2025

Students attending the camp will:

  • Stay in college dorms for the duration of the camp
  • Experience various cultural activities including traditional games and ceremonies
  • Explore careers in the healthcare and long-term care sectors
  • Engage with Tribal community healthcare professionals
  • Go on fun excursions and exciting site visits

Honoring Health, Wellness, and Tradition

Applications will open in February 2025. For more information regarding the program, please contact Cassandra Nicholson at cnicholson*AT*fdltcc.edu.

Applicants must be students living or attending school in Minnesota and entering grades 9 – 12 during the 2025-2026 school year.  Applications require signature of parent or guardian.
